In recent decades, authors affiliated with Carnegie Institution for Science have published 14.9k papers, which have received a total of 1.0M indexed citations. Scholars at this organization have produced 3.6k papers in Astronomy and Astrophysics, 3.3k papers in Geophysics and 2.7k papers in Molecular Biology on the topics of High-pressure geophysics and materials (2.6k papers), Geological and Geochemical Analysis (1.9k papers) and Stellar, planetary, and galactic studies (1.8k papers). Their work is cited by papers focused on Molecular Biology (254.8k citations), Geophysics (175.0k citations) and Plant Science (165.9k citations). Authors at Carnegie Institution for Science collaborate with scholars in United States, United Kingdom and China and have published in prestigious journals including Nature, Science and Cell. Some of Carnegie Institution for Science's most productive authors include Russell J. Hemley, Gregory P. Asner, Christopher B. Field, Joseph A. Berry and Arthur Grossman.
